A console server (also console access server or console management server) is a service that provides access to the operator console of an IT asset via networking technologies. Console servers are typically used with serial devices such as routers and GNU/Linux servers, but can be discussed as part of a wider concept; including industrial and automation devices, out-of-band management, logging and monitoring.
